Comment * document.getElementById("comment").setAttribute( "id", "a92c55ab09363e4624236ce724e3c1a6" );document.getElementById("b4ee39581b").setAttribute( "id", "comment" ); In this tutorial, we are going to see What is a Web Worker in JavaScript? Answer (1 of 6): If it is only used in the frontend Then you can store them in: * Local storage * Session storage * Cookies * WebDB * Indexed DB Otherwise you can save them on the server in your database and retreive the value using an api call Not really possible without server side code. If you want to refresh a web page using a mouse click, then you can use the following code . I want to make such as facebook link will be #!/anythinge I want to remove #! That window (the page with the pics) will then display the new rating and number of votes it gets from the database. Connect and share knowledge within a single location that is structured and easy to search. I could not think of a simple way to detect when a page was The location.reload () method reloads the current web page. But if we only want to refresh the current page, we can do so by not passing any parameters or by passing 0 (a neutral value): Note: This also works the same way as we added the reload() method to the setTimeOut() method and the click event in HTML. Thus, on a page load JavaScript can check to see if a hidden variable that defaults to being unset is set. users should be encouraged to do such a simple search first, encourage to read.. @amosrivera - Indicated by the ratio of upvotes to downvotes on this question, there is a silent majority of users who very much appreciate being able to find answers to questions like this on Stackoverflow, @stefan: Thankfully, Google brought me (and thousands of others) here -- to find the, Sadly, when you googgle for "auto refreshing a page via js" this one is the first page which appears, so not answering here is kinda pointless :). Write a piece of code, click "Submit" and the . Difficulties with estimation of epsilon-delta limit proof, Styling contours by colour and by line thickness in QGIS. Otherwise it is assumed to be a fresh load. Find centralized, trusted content and collaborate around the technologies you use most. How can I force clients to refresh JavaScript files? 2: Working with browswer history (Bakc and Forward). rev2023.3.3.43278. expiration = new Date; expiration. What video game is Charlie playing in Poker Face S01E07? We can also allow a page refersh after a fixed time use the setTimeOut () method as seen below: setTimeout ( () => { document.location.reload (); }, 3000); Using the code above our web page will reload every 3 seconds. question like this should be closed. Use window.onbeforeunload to store the time and the URL of your current page (in localstorage) when the user leaves the page (potentially refreshes the page). How can I refresh a page using JavaScript or HTML? Typing URL in a browser. (adsbygoogle = window.adsbygoogle || []).push({}); Your email address will not be published. freeCodeCamp's open source curriculum has helped more than 40,000 people get jobs as developers. $6.00. How do I check if an array includes a value in JavaScript? 'preventDefault()' will stop the default function of the key pressed. I tried to make a simple count buttom. From MDN reference 2022: Navigation Timing Level 2 specification. Get started, freeCodeCamp is a donor-supported tax-exempt 501(c)(3) charity organization (United States Federal Tax Identification Number: 82-0779546).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Please use the PerformanceNavigationTiming interface instead. a method that can be wrapped up almost entirely in a When the page refreshes or reloads, it will show any new data based off those user interactions. Is it possible to create a concave light? Affordable solution to train a team and make them project ready. How can I change an element's class with JavaScript? So far, we've seen how to use the reload method in our HTML file when . Enjoy unlimited access on 5500+ Hand Picked Quality Video Courses. rev2023.3.3.43278. What sort of strategies would a medieval military use against a fantasy giant? A better way to know that the page is actually reloaded is to use the navigator object that is supported by most modern browsers. matches the name of the page and the time cookie differs by the A Computer Science portal for geeks. In the body section of the code, we gave the 5 seconds, which you can change as per your requirement. For example: www.yoursite.com/ver-01/about.js. It is how we can use JavaScript to refresh a web page automatically every 5 seconds. To avoid that we will use the local storage to persist our timer data. The location.reload() method reloads the current URL like the refresh button of the browser. You can make a tax-deductible donation here. # react # reactcountdown. But this isn't the case. Tweet a thanks, Learn to code for free. There is a problem. Initially, I thought that I'll just put the sentences in an array and then use cookies to count the number of refreshes and then display the corresponding sentence according to the number of refreshes. Step 2 (User presses submit click): If user presses submit button, it will call the necessary JavaScript function to create the new fresh GUID again. Did any of the solutions below work for you? Why did Ukraine abstain from the UNHRC vote on China? In this tutorial, we are going to see different methods to refresh a page in Javascript. When a certain link is clicked, the script is supposed to read in a .txt file and assign it to a variable, increment the value by 1, then write . Copy link Tweet this. For this purpose, the history API seems most sensible, because its state is tied to the page instance. The following samples use the Get OAuth V2 Info policy to retrieve information about various components of the OAuth2 workflow and then then access that information within code. Syntax of setInterval() Method. 1. Using this method in JavaScript, a code can be called automatically upon an event or when a user clicks on a link. MCQPractice competitive and technical Multiple Choice Questions and Answers (MCQs) with simple and logical explanations to prepare for tests and interviews.Read More and it sets it. go ( 0 ); javascript link redirect data types. When you're developing applications like a blog or a page where the data may change based on user actions, you'll want that page to refresh frequently. Using Kolmogorov complexity to measure difficulty of problems? You would then be informed whether the form [] Web Worker allows us to. This code will count the times that the visitor visited a page. Staging Ground Beta 1 Recap, and Reviewers needed for Beta 2. @Ahmed I am trying to do the same thing. Can I play instants between taps due to Hidden Strings? Anyone know of a way of counting page reloads on the client side? Published Dec 1989 by Aircel. Find centralized, trusted content and collaborate around the technologies you use most. I copied that js into a separate file and added a heading just as in the fiddle but nothing shows up on my page (yes I did link the js by script src). Plus, Asking for help, clarification, or responding to other answers. changed value will be used after the refresh. Here I give a common method using JavaScript and For e.g- on the first refresh, the following statement shows up - "1 refresh, keep going" and so on. Is it correct to use "the" before "materials used in making buildings are"? The history function is usually used to navigate back or forth by passing in either a positive or negative value. case where the page posts data back to itself, it can prevent the 2023 C# Corner. On refresh check if your cookie exists and if it does, alert. 0. Required fields are marked *. Check the console for errors. I need to print up to 10 sentences at least. Note: For all Date fields, the time is formatted according to the current user's Time Format preference, set at Home > Set Preferences. Can Martian regolith be easily melted with microwaves? I need to get this thing up and running. One of the straightforward options is to use localStorage in the browser to persist the state. Barry Blair and Dave Cooper. The meta tags don't appear on the page. A page can be refreshed or reloaded by doing the following things. W3Schools offers free online tutorials, references and exercises in all the major languages of the web. If it is unset, it assumes this is not a refresh How to Reload a Page Using the JavaScript History Function. You just need to get the value on load of the page and show it, before incrementing the value when the page is reloaded. Where does this (supposedly) Gibson quote come from? Try the following example. So does this work on Safari in 2022? SessionStorage can be modified from within browser? So far we have seen how reload works in JavaScript. How to use Slater Type Orbitals as a basis functions in matrix method correctly? I found some information in JavaScript Detecting Page Refresh. Learn different ways of persisting React state between page reloads. google_ad_width = 468; Manually refreshing the web page seems a time-wasting process and effort as we can now automatically refresh web pages in our browsers with the help of JavaScript. Why do academics stay as adjuncts for years rather than move around? How Intuit democratizes AI development across teams through reusability. Code Component: for example: Compare it to the stored versionnumber (stored in cookie or localStorage) if user has visited the page once, otherwise store it directly. How do I modify the URL without reloading the page? Body Count (1989 Aircel) comic books 1970-0986. window.setInterval(code, delay) @Brannon - Yes, if the browser is left open and the user re-visits after some time, it will not be considered as a new visit. I can give this a lot of uses for functionalities and analytics. Our mission: to help people learn to code for free. Refresh using Button. Good news you can implement this type of functionality in JavaScript with a single line of code. I need to print up to 10 sentences at least. Let's first discuss Meta tags. I want to count the number of times my web page is "refreshed". If we will pass false, then too, the page will get refresh but the page will be fetched from cache. All Issues; In Stock; Display. To do this just copy and write these block of codes inside the text editor, then save it as script.js inside the js folder. This method will reload the current document, which will refresh the page. We can refresh the current page using the method reload() of the window.location object. For example, whenever you had to fill out a web form, you had to fill out your information, hit the submit button and then wait for the webpage to reload. Side note: the first method listed on that page will fail because the code is executing before the DOM has been parsed. In this article, we are going to implement a JavaScript code that would allow us to reload a page only once. So far, we've seen how to use the reload method in our HTML file when we attach it to specific events, as well as in our JavaScript file. If we tend to refresh the page, we can do so by not passing any parameters or by passing 0. history. . Wouldn't this still pose a problem if the user revisits the site before that cookie is destroyed? Agree For me, this method is working great, maybe it can help you too. For e.g- on the first refresh, the following statement shows up - "1 refresh, keep going" and so on. I recommend the triple solution complex! Do new devs get fired if they can't solve a certain bug? Can I play instants between taps due to Hidden Strings? @techfoobar nice catch. You can specify how frequently to refresh the page, and it will be loaded non-stop: Then, you can use it with onload event, for example, on the body of the page like so: The history function is usually used to navigate back or forth by passing in either a positive or negative value. If the name cookie reset (a "shift-refresh") while in others it works with both. Using the location.reload method and the setTimeout() function; we can refresh a web page every 5 seconds. We use the following code if we want to refresh a web page using a mouse click. The History function is another method for refreshing a page. To automatically refresh or reload a page in Vue.js, you can make use of the window.location.reload () method.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. How to refresh a page whenever my json data file changes, How to refresh page, after async function is executed. The difference between the phonemes /p/ and /b/ in Japanese. In JavaScript, we used the setTimeout function to execute the location.reload () in the code. But they also don't work and I get half of my print statement on my web page. google_color_url = "008000"; So I use JavaScript cookies. - the incident has nothing to do with me; can I use this this way? We hope you find this article helpful in understanding how to use JavaScript to refresh a web page automatically. hidden form variables which I did not use as well as a unique (as Make a div fill the height of the remaining screen space. What do you need it for? Linear regulator thermal information missing in datasheet. setting of the cookie so that the next load won't look like a This is fully working example for your reference. You can still achieve what you require using cookies, or even localStorage or sessionStorage. Someone can add/delete the key and your logic/code can be circumvented. So depending in your code this is extremely useful, either to register every time the page has been refreshed, reloaded or any ajax interaction. I would prefer See Same-origin policy for more information. You will see any changes made on the page. So, it depends on the requirements what to use. The setTimeout() is a built-in JavaScript function that we use to execute another function after a given time interval.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. Turns page refresh on or off. 2 => back button clicked. This method is longer, but I believe it is tighter and more That is, even though a page is refreshed, if a hidden We can also set the http-equiv meta tag which will automatically refresh the page at a given interval. google_ad_format = "468x60_as"; Do not use this to check refresh. Additionally, nearly all false location.reload(true); was the solution, as the default is indeed false, as Nabi K.A.Z. so that I Making statements based on opinion; back them up with references or personal experience. My index.html file contains this script at the end to run the above script which is stored in a different file named counter.php. Say you want to display a numeric value on a webpage with a count-up animation, like this: There are a few popular libraries that will do this for you, often with lots of configurable bells and whistles. On the contrary previous scenario, if an entry for the "page_view" key is already present, the retrieved String value is converted to a number datatype using Number(). Do new devs get fired if they can't solve a certain bug? robust. We can use any of the below statements to reload the same page. He refuses to either set a value on a cookie onbeforeonload or to have something on the server side that can count. Starting in Winter '21, you'll be able to use getRecordNotifyChange () function to refresh your record page from a lightning web component. Optional parameters force reload is a boolean value, which if set to: True reloads the page from the server (e.g. Does not work when re-opening a tab using ctrl/cmd+T, Check if page gets reloaded or refreshed in JavaScript, developer.mozilla.org/en-US/docs/Web/API/PerformanceNavigation, MDN reference 2022: Navigation Timing Level 2 specification, How Intuit democratizes AI development across teams through reusability. After running this code, the web page will refresh automatically every 5 seconds. vegan) just to try it, does this inconvenience the caterers and staff? We accomplish this by creating thousands of videos, articles, and interactive coding lessons - all freely available to the public. thanks buddy this is accurate solution to detect either the page is reloaded from right click/refresh from the browser or reloaded by the url.
Jasper County, Missouri Assessor Property Search, California Cpi Increase 2022, Who Is Marcus Black Baby Mama, Patricianashdesigns Register, Sports Memorabilia Buyers, Articles P